首页 > 其他 > 详细

Docker的安装

时间:2021-08-05 15:52:21      阅读:13      评论:0      收藏:0      [点我收藏+]

1.确保yum包更新到最新

sudo yum update -y

2.卸载已经安装的Docker

 sudo yum remove docker                    docker-client                    docker-client-latest                    docker-common                    docker-latest                    docker-latest-logrotate                    docker-logrotate                    docker-selinux                    docker-engine-selinux                    docker-engine

3.安装工具包, yum-util 提供yum-config-manager功能,另外两个是devicemapper驱动依赖的

sudo yum install -y yum-utils device-mapper-persistent-data lvm2

4.添加yum源仓库地址

1.官方源地址,下载慢不推荐,推荐下面的阿里源的方式

sudo y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o

2.阿里源地址

sudo yum-config-manager --add-repo http://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o

5.查看可安装版本列表

yum list docker-ce --showduplicates | sort -r
技术分享图片

6.下载安装Docker

1.指定版本号的方式安装

sudo yum install -y docker-ce-17.12.0.ce

2.不指定版本号默认安装当前最新版本

sudo yum install -y docker-ce docker-ce-cli containerd.io

7.验证是否安装成功

docker version
技术分享图片

8.启动并加入开机启动

sudo systemctl start docker
sudo systemctl enable docker

9.配置Docker镜像站

1.由于国内用户从Docker Hub中拉取镜像比较慢且不稳定所提供的方式之一

# 该脚本可以将 --registry-mirror 加入到你的 Docker 配置文件 /etc/docker/daemon.json 中。适用于 Ubuntu14.04、Debian、CentOS6 、CentOS7、Fedora、Arch Linux、openSUSE Leap 42.1,其他版本可能有细微不同。更多详情请访问https://www.daocloud.io/mirror#accelerator-doc。
curl -sSL https://get.daocloud.io/daotools/set_mirror.sh | sh -s http://f1361db2.m.daocloud.io
# 重启生效
sudo systemctl daemon-reload //重新加载服务配置文件
sudo systemctl restart docker.service   //设置开机启动与重启docker服务

Docker的安装

原文:https://www.cnblogs.com/jetty-96/p/15103115.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!